Encopresis
Failure to control the bowels after the normal age for bowel control has been reached. Also called soiling.
Rhoda Kellogg
An influential figure in the study of children’s art and developmental psychology, particularly known for her work on the scribbling stage in young children’s artistic development.
Basic Scribbles
The initial form of drawing by children, characterized by repetitive motifs, which is a fundamental stage in the development of graphic representation.
